What is responsible for the peristalsis that occurs in the digestive tract?

Answer:

Peristalsis moves food through the digestive system. When muscles contract, food is pushed to an area of relaxation. The muscles above the food contract further, pushing the food along. It occurs in the esophagus and intestines.
